免费看操逼电影1_99r这里只有精品12_久久久.n_日本护士高潮小说_无码良品_av在线1…_国产精品亚洲系列久久_色檀色AV导航_操逼操 亚洲_看在线黄色AV_A级无码乱伦黑料专区国产_高清极品嫩模喷水a片_超碰18禁_监国产盗摄视频在线观看_国产淑女操逼网站

Happ開發(fā)基礎(chǔ):如何構(gòu)建響應(yīng)式移動(dòng)界面?

Happ開發(fā)基礎(chǔ):如何構(gòu)建響應(yīng)式移動(dòng)界面?

在移動(dòng)設(shè)備使用率已超過桌面端的2025年,??超過73%的用戶會(huì)因?yàn)榻缑孢m配問題而放棄使用一個(gè)應(yīng)用??。這種痛點(diǎn)在Happ開發(fā)中尤為突出——開發(fā)者常常面臨不同設(shè)備尺寸、分辨率碎片化以及用戶交互習(xí)慣差異的挑戰(zhàn)。響應(yīng)式設(shè)計(jì)已從"加分項(xiàng)"變?yōu)?必選項(xiàng)",它直接關(guān)系到用戶留存率和商業(yè)轉(zhuǎn)化效率。


理解響應(yīng)式設(shè)計(jì)的核心邏輯

??響應(yīng)式設(shè)計(jì)不是簡單的縮放布局??,而是一套基于設(shè)備特性動(dòng)態(tài)調(diào)整內(nèi)容呈現(xiàn)方式的系統(tǒng)工程。它的三大支柱包括:

  • ??流體網(wǎng)格系統(tǒng)??:使用百分比或fr單位替代固定像素值,使元素能夠根據(jù)容器寬度自動(dòng)調(diào)整
  • ??彈性媒體資源??:通過max-width:100%確保圖片視頻不溢出容器,結(jié)合srcset屬性提供多分辨率適配
  • ??媒體查詢斷點(diǎn)??:基于主流設(shè)備尺寸設(shè)置布局變化臨界點(diǎn),常見劃分包括:
    • 手機(jī):<768px
    • 平板:768-992px
    • 桌面:>1200px

個(gè)人實(shí)踐中發(fā)現(xiàn),??過早設(shè)置過多斷點(diǎn)反而會(huì)增加維護(hù)成本??。建議先基于核心業(yè)務(wù)場(chǎng)景確定2-3個(gè)關(guān)鍵斷點(diǎn),再根據(jù)用戶數(shù)據(jù)分析結(jié)果逐步細(xì)化。


關(guān)鍵技術(shù)實(shí)現(xiàn)路徑

視口配置與單位選擇

在HTML頭部必須添加基礎(chǔ)視口標(biāo)簽:

這行代碼告訴瀏覽器??按照設(shè)備邏輯像素渲染頁面??,避免默認(rèn)的桌面端縮放行為。

長度單位的選擇策略:

Happ開發(fā)基礎(chǔ):如何構(gòu)建響應(yīng)式移動(dòng)界面?
  • ??rem??:基于根元素字體大小,適合全局間距和字體縮放
  • ??vw/vh??:直接關(guān)聯(lián)視口尺寸,適合全屏元素
  • ??em??:繼承父級(jí)字體大小,適合組件內(nèi)部相對(duì)調(diào)整

實(shí)測(cè)數(shù)據(jù)顯示,混合使用rem和vw單位能在布局靈活性和視覺一致性間取得最佳平衡。

布局引擎的智能選擇

現(xiàn)代CSS提供三種主流響應(yīng)式布局方案:

方案適用場(chǎng)景優(yōu)勢(shì)
Flexbox一維線性布局動(dòng)態(tài)分配空間
CSS Grid復(fù)雜二維布局精確控制行列
浮動(dòng)布局傳統(tǒng)兼容方案瀏覽器支持廣

??Flexbox特別適合移動(dòng)端導(dǎo)航欄和卡片列表??,其flex-wrap屬性可以智能處理換行問題。而Grid布局在構(gòu)建儀表盤等復(fù)雜界面時(shí)效率更高,通過grid-template-columns: repeat(auto-fill, minmax(200px, 1fr))即可實(shí)現(xiàn)自適應(yīng)網(wǎng)格。


性能優(yōu)化實(shí)戰(zhàn)策略

響應(yīng)式設(shè)計(jì)常被忽視的代價(jià)是??移動(dòng)端不必要的資源加載??。通過以下方法可顯著提升性能:

  1. ??圖片智能適配??

這種方案比CSS縮放節(jié)省約40%的帶寬消耗。

  1. ??條件加載資源??
    使用Intersection Observer API實(shí)現(xiàn)懶加載,當(dāng)元素進(jìn)入視口時(shí)才觸發(fā)資源請(qǐng)求。

    Happ開發(fā)基礎(chǔ):如何構(gòu)建響應(yīng)式移動(dòng)界面?
  2. ??CSS分層處理??
    將核心樣式內(nèi)聯(lián),非關(guān)鍵樣式異步加載,可使首屏渲染速度提升2-3秒。


超越基礎(chǔ)的進(jìn)階技巧

觸摸交互優(yōu)化

移動(dòng)端需要特別考慮??手指操作的熱區(qū)大小??,建議:

  • 按鈕尺寸不小于44×44px
  • 表單元素間距大于8mm
  • 避免hover狀態(tài)作為核心功能觸發(fā)

黑暗模式適配

通過CSS變量實(shí)現(xiàn)主題切換:

這種方案比單獨(dú)維護(hù)兩套樣式節(jié)省60%的代碼量。

框架集成策略

在Happ開發(fā)中,??過度依賴Bootstrap等框架可能導(dǎo)致代碼冗余??。更推薦采用"按需引入"策略,比如只使用其柵格系統(tǒng)而非全套組件?,F(xiàn)代工具如Tailwind CSS提供了更輕量級(jí)的響應(yīng)式工具類,通過md:text-lg這樣的類名即可實(shí)現(xiàn)斷點(diǎn)特定樣式。


持續(xù)迭代的設(shè)計(jì)思維

響應(yīng)式界面不是一次性的開發(fā)任務(wù)。通過??用戶行為分析工具??收集不同設(shè)備上的交互數(shù)據(jù),可以發(fā)現(xiàn)意料之外的適配問題。某電商平臺(tái)的數(shù)據(jù)顯示,??在平板設(shè)備上優(yōu)化商品圖片的縮放邏輯后,轉(zhuǎn)化率提升了17%??。

Happ開發(fā)基礎(chǔ):如何構(gòu)建響應(yīng)式移動(dòng)界面?

未來趨勢(shì)已顯現(xiàn):??基于AI的設(shè)備特征識(shí)別??將逐步替代傳統(tǒng)的斷點(diǎn)判斷。系統(tǒng)可以自動(dòng)檢測(cè)設(shè)備性能、網(wǎng)絡(luò)狀況甚至環(huán)境光線,動(dòng)態(tài)調(diào)整界面復(fù)雜度和資源質(zhì)量。這種"智能響應(yīng)"模式可能成為下一個(gè)十年的行業(yè)標(biāo)準(zhǔn)。


本文原地址:http://m.czyjwy.com/news/135099.html
本站文章均來自互聯(lián)網(wǎng),僅供學(xué)習(xí)參考,如有侵犯您的版權(quán),請(qǐng)郵箱聯(lián)系我們刪除!
上一篇:HTML App性能優(yōu)化與常見問題解決方案
下一篇:HTML App數(shù)據(jù)存儲(chǔ)與本地交互的解決方案